[Bug 1838038] Re: [snap] Snapped apps do not work with .local mdns/avahi name resolution

2020-01-24 Thread Till Kamppeter
I have to install nscd on the host machine and then restart snapd and my snap: sudo systemctl restart snapd sudo snap restart printing-stack-snap and after that cups-browsed succeeds to resolve .local host names. -- You received this bug notification because you are a member of Ubuntu Bugs, whi
